Lego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ga was introduced in 2019 and is now set to attend this year’s Gamescom event.

Lego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ga was originally scheduled to be released last spring, but at the last minute, we saw a delay. This game deals with the story of all nine Star Wars movies. You have the option to completely discard any part you do not like (any of the prequels or sequels). 

It has now been confirmed that Lego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ga will be opening at Gamescom 2021.

Now that Disney has decided to revive the Lucasfilm Games brand, Lego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ga will be one of the first released games. The game is being developed by TT Games Studio, a developer that makes only Lego games and has therefore gained worldwide fame.

Lego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ga has no release date yet, but will likely be released in 2021 for the P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Xbox One, Xbox X / S Series, PC, and Nintendo Switch.

The highly anticipated release L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ga was delayed (again) in April, but it seems TT Games will soon be showing us a little more.

According to Geoff Keighley, a new look “world premiere” of the upcoming Lego Star Wars game will be shown off at Gamescom’s Opening Night Live – taking place next week on 25th August. Hopefully, the trailer locks in the release date.

TT Games delayed the game for a second time, and it explained how the team wanted to make it the “biggest and best-ever” Lego video game.
